Obama's new challenge: Disappointment By: Jonathan Allen September 1, 2012 07:07 AM EDT
The watchword of the Republican National Convention in Tampa was disappointment as in President Barack Obama has been one.
You can hammer Obama on health care. Mock his golf outings. Demand to see his birth certificate and Harvard transcript, and call him a European socialist bent on turning the American Dream into a Belgian nightmare. Hell throw his head back and laugh at you like a Bond villain.
But tell voters hes not the man America fell in love with in 2008 and pine, however disingenuously, about his unfulfilled potential and a shiver runs through his Chicago campaign headquarters.
Obamas team was spinning the convention as a complete miss, arguing that Republicans didnt lay a glove on their man. Yet what emerged from Tampa was a subtle, clever shift in GOP messaging, a much more dangerous strategy for Obama than the kitchen-sink attacks that preceded the gathering. Republicans posed rhetorically as Obama 2008 voters, lamenting his unfulfilled expectations as if they had been with him all along instead of trying to block him at every turn.
Both sides recognize the power of the disappointment theme: that the hope Obama offered for mending the economy, transforming the political process and even saving the earth has faded.
President Obama promised to begin to slow the rise of the oceans and heal the planet, Mitt Romney said in accepting the Republican presidential nomination Thursday. My promise is to help you and your family.
